Key facts from Lakes at Ascension Crossing Homeowners Association, Inc.'s documents
- Community type
- Homeowners Association (HOA) (Preamble; Section III)
- Governing law
- Louisiana Revised Statutes 9:1145, et seq. (for lien/privilege) (Section 6.8)
- Assessments & dues
- Initial regular assessment $20.00 per month ($240 per year) until January 1, 2004. (Section 6.3)
- Special assessments
- Allowed for capital improvements as per Article VI (Section 6.1(b)). No specific percentage limitation stated. (Section 6.1(b))
- Collections & liens
- Association has privilege against the Lot in accordance with La. R.S. 9:1145 et seq.; may file Notice of Delinquency, Lien and Privilege; may bring action in rem to enforce real obligation and privilege. (Section 6.8)
- Reserves & fees
- Not explicitly stated as a flat fee; interest of 12% per annum from date of delinquency. (Section 6.8)
- Pets
- Generally recognized house pets may be kept, subject to Association rules and regulations, kept solely as domestic pets not for commercial purpose. (Section 7.47)
- Leasing & rentals
- Not explicitly addressed in the provided text. No mention of leasing restrictions.
- Parking & vehicles
- No mobile homes, house trailers, trucks (other than pickup trucks), or other commercial vehicles may be kept, stored, parked, repaired or maintained on any Lot. (Section 7.44)
- Fences
- All fence locations and details must be submitted to Committee for approval. No fence nearer to street than building setback line or front of residence. Maximum height 6 feet. Materials: brick or wood; chain link/wire prohibited. Wood fence (Section 7.13)
- Architectural approval
- Yes, all plans for initial construction and any subsequent additions, changes, or alterations must be submitted to and approved in writing by the Committee (Developer Committee then Homeowner Committee). (Sections 4.1(a), 4.4, 7.5)
- Solar & roof
- Solar collectors are not permitted. (Section 7.27)
- Home business
- Use of portion of Lot as office by Owner not considered non-commercial if no regular customer, client or employee traffic, but no storage for building contractor or real estate developer. (Section 7.1)
- Signs & flags
- No signs except one standard (16"x24") real estate sign and one builder sign, professionally constructed, must be maintained. Developer and entity acquiring substantially all Lots excepted. (Section 7.41)
- Setbacks / home size
- No residence less than 2,400 square feet of heated living area (excluding open porches, screens, garages, etc.). (Section 7.6)
- Maintenance

- Use restrictions
- All Lots for residential purposes only; no commercial use except as expressly permitted; no apartment houses, lodging houses, schools, churches, assembly halls, group homes. (Section 7.1)
- Voting & meetings
- One vote per Lot; Owners of multiple Lots have one vote per Lot; when multiple Owners of a single Lot, vote is exercised as they determine but only one vote cast per Lot. Only one class of membership. (Section 3.3)
- Amendments
